How much does a Wawa HR Analyst make?

As of April 2025, the average annual salary for a HR Analyst at Wawa is $80,486, which translates to approximately $39 per hour. Salaries for HR Analyst at Wawa typically range from $73,135 to $87,093, reflecting the diverse roles within the company.

It's essential to understand that salaries can vary significantly based on factors such as geographic location, departmental budget, and individual qualifications. Key determinants include years of experience, specific skill sets, educational background, and relevant certifications. For a more tailored salary estimate, consider these variables when evaluating compensation for this role.

Founded in 1964 and headquartered in Wawa, Pennsylvania, Wawa is a convenience store and fueling station chain with locations throughout the United States.

  3. Job Evaluation: A job evaluation is a systematic way of determining the value/worth of a job in relation to other jobs in an organization. It tries to make a systematic comparison between jobs to assess their relative worth for the purpose of establishing a rational pay structure. Job evaluation needs to be differentiated from job analysis. Job analysis is a systematic way of gathering information about a job. Every job evaluation method requires at least some basic job analysis in order to provide factual information about the jobs concerned. Thus, job evaluation begins with job analysis and ends at that point where the worth of a job is ascertained for achieving pay equity between jobs and different roles.
